https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Model_year
so, one of vagaries of US federal law, is that techically, a vehicle can be sold as the next model year starting on 1 Jan of the previous year.

so, MY22 vehicles can be sold on 1 Jan 2021.

we might all be getting MY22 broncos!:p

Nope, he just said earlier that 2022 would likely order in February.
If you don't order by January 31st, you don't have a Bronco order. After EVERYONE has ordered, Ford should know by February who will be getting the MY21.

If demand exceeds what they can make, you'll be informed of that by February, hopefully.

If your order is outside the MY21 then you'll have to create a new order for MY22 as options, price, etc can all be different from your original order.
